The ER Immerse Program will prepare veterinarians for a sustainable and satisfying career in emergency medicine. Built to be different from traditional rotating internship programs, it focuses on core competencies essential for an emergency veterinarian, including client and team member communication, professional skills, and life/work integration. The program uses a hybrid training approach with simulation-based didactics and live-patient experiences, designed around an evidence-based strategy to identify essential competencies. Program Details
Program Duration/Commitment : 6 month training program beginning summer 2026 (rolling start dates available); 24 month commitment as an ER clinician at USV-G following training.
